[Qgis-developer] svn is broken
Marco Hugentobler
marco.hugentobler at karto.baug.ethz.ch
Sat Jul 7 02:31:07 EDT 2007
Hi all,
Sorry, my fault. I didn't realize that I changed the public interface when
doing r7063. I'm going to commit a change soon that uses the same interface
for QgsVectorLayer as before r7063. Because developers are no longer allowed
to change the interface without making RFCs. In the case of r7063, the bugfix
can be done without changing the interface.
Marco
On Saturday 07 July 2007 08:17:13 Gary Sherman wrote:
> This looks like it needs a MappedType definition for QSet<QString> in
> qgsvectorlayer.sip, similar to that for QSet<int> in
> qgsvectordataprovider.sip.
>
> The latest commit (r7064) does not fix the issue.
>
> -gary
>
> On Jul 6, 2007, at 9:55 PM, <bmoskovi at surewest.net>
>
> <bmoskovi at surewest.net> wrote:
> > I just wanted to inform you all that I tried to update qgis to the
> > latest svn and got the following error:
> >
> > sipcoreQgsVectorLayer.cpp: In function 'PyObject*
> > meth_QgsVectorLayer_commitAttributeChanges(PyObject*, PyObject*)':
> > sipcoreQgsVectorLayer.cpp:1629: error: no matching function for
> > call to 'QgsVectorLayer::commitAttributeChanges(const QSet<int>&,
> > const QMap<QString, QString>&, const QMap<int, QMap<int, QVariant>
> >
> > >&)'
> >
> > /home/bobm/src/gis/qgis_unstable/src/core/qgsvectorlayer.h:321:
> > note: candidates are: bool QgsVectorLayer::commitAttributeChanges
> > (const QgsDeletedAttributesSet&, const QgsNewAttributesMap&, const
> > QgsChangedAttributesMap&)
> > gmake[3]: *** [sipcoreQgsVectorLayer.o] Error 1
> > make[2]: *** [python/core/core.so] Error 2
> > make[1]: *** [python/CMakeFiles/python.dir/all] Error 2
> > make: *** [all] Error 2
> >
> > About a weeks ago, I was able to update from svn with no problems.
> >
> > Regards,
> > Bob (aka cgs_bob on irc)
> > _______________________________________________
> > Qgis-developer mailing list
> > Qgis-developer at lists.qgis.org
> > http://lists.qgis.org/cgi-bin/mailman/listinfo/qgis-developer
>
> -_-_-_-_-_-_-_-_-_-_-_-_-_-_-_-_-_-_-_-_-
> Gary Sherman
> Chair, QGIS Project Steering Committee
> Micro Resources: http://mrcc.com
> *Geospatial Hosting
> *Web Site Hosting
> "We work virtually everywhere"
> -_-_-_-_-_-_-_-_-_-_-_-_-_-_-_-_-_-_-_-_-
>
>
>
> _______________________________________________
> Qgis-developer mailing list
> Qgis-developer at lists.qgis.org
> http://lists.qgis.org/cgi-bin/mailman/listinfo/qgis-developer
--
Dr. Marco Hugentobler
Institute of Cartography
ETH Zurich
Technical Advisor QGIS Project Steering Committee
marco.hugentobler at karto.baug.ethz.ch
More information about the Qgis-developer
mailing list